STORE.LIVERPOOLFC.COMMatchday Programme: LFC vs Brighton – Premier League – 13/12/2025The Reds return to Anfield on Saturday when they take on Brighton & Hove Albion in the Premier League. The matchday programme is the perfect souvenir for the clash with Fabian Hürzeler’s side.Inside, we hear from defender Joe Gomez, the latest member of Liverpool FC’s 250 Club, as he reflects on the team’s recent run and previous challenging times during his decade with the club. Winger Cody Gakpo also speaks candidly about the Reds’ results and explains why he is confident that the squad will turn their fortunes around. We have the pre-match insights of head coach Arne Slot and captain Virgil van Dijk in their exclusive columns and also get the views of ex-Reds defender Gary Gillespie. Prominent LFC journalist James Pearce discusses his new book telling the story of last season’s title triumph, while we also catch-up with writer Rhys Buchanan who reflects on a memorable midweek in Milan. We put the focus on a special piece of memorabilia 100 years after the signing of a Liverpool goalscoring great and celebrate the 45th anniversary of the Reds’ all-time leading marksman making his debut for the club. There is a round-up of the latest match action, an update from the Reds’ women’s and academy teams plus some teasers for younger supporters and a focus on goalkeeper Giorgi Mamardashvili. Our popular feature looking at stadiums at which Liverpool previously played naturally takes us to Brighton’s former home, the Goldstone Ground, we put the spotlight (well floodlights) on half-a-dozen great Anfield images and continue the story of Liverpool FC’s only Double-winning season to date, forty years on.0 Comments 0 Shares 602 Views 0 Reviews -

Arne Slot admitted he went against the advice of his performance staff regarding Florian Wirtz as the Liverpool playmaker starred in a 2-0 win over West Ham United. The Germany international had missed the last two games with an injury after returning from the break with an issue.
"Recently I’ve been asked a lot about individuals when maybe they’ve played a game not of their usual standards and I’ve pointed out the team every single time.
“After a very positive performance from Florian, I can acknowledge that but I also want to emphasise the team performance was much better.
“We tried to create an extra midfielder and he was very important for us to find that extra midfielder every time. He was good when he made a dribble, he was good with his one-touch passes, he played one ball to Cody which then doesn’t lead to a shot but we had many of those moments and he was part of many of them.
“Performance staff were constantly telling me ‘he needs to go out’ because he’d be out for one-and-a-half weeks and had only trained once, so to a certain extent it was maybe a bit of a risk to keep him in the team but some situations ask for an exception, and today was one of them."π΄ Arne Slot admitted he went against the advice of his performance staff regarding Florian Wirtz as the Liverpool playmaker starred in a 2-0 win over West Ham United. Florian Wirtz was assessed as Liverpool’s best player in the 2-0 victory at West Ham, with an unsung figure getting the second-highest rating.
Wirtz (8.03) delivered a hugely promising display, standing out as the best player on either side.
Ian Doyle of the Echo described the German as the “most creative player throughout,” praising the key part he played in Isak’s opener.
Jack McRae of GOAL said this was Wirtz’s “best performance in a Liverpool shirt” to date, with the 22-year-old thriving as a No. 10.
For Isak , it was huge to score his first Liverpool goal in the Premier League, but he will know that he needs to improve in his all-round game.
